Division overview:

Crown’s Closures, Aerosol & Promotional Packaging (CAPP) Division manufactures a variety of packaging solutions for the largest consumer packaging companies in North America. Our distinguished list of clients including SC Johnson, WD40, Barbasol, Abbott Laboratories and Unilever. We manufacture total packaging solutions including:

  • Closures: We manufacture a variety of decorative food and metal vacuum sealed closures, metal and composite closures, capping systems for glass and plastic container manufacturers.
  • Aerosol Packaging: We manufacture cans and ends for manufacturers of personal care, food, household and industrial products. We offer our customers a broad range of products including multiple sizes, color schemes and shaped packaging.
  • Promotional and Specialty Packaging: We manufacture a wide array of decorative containers with numerous lid and closure variations.

Location:

This fast-paced manufacturing facility making over 13 million aerosol cans a month is located in Spartanburg, SC.

Position overview:

The Production Operator will perform a variety of equipment operations and visual quality checks, in the production and manufacture of 3-piece aerosol cans of the highest quality at the lowest possible costs, under the direction of the Shift Supervisor. 

Duties And Responsibilities:

Responsibilities would include, but not be limited to the following:

  • Verify correct materials per customer specifications for the production process.
  • Load materials into manufacturing equipment – must lift up to 40-50 lbs.
  • Stop and start manufacturing equipment as necessary.
  • Remove minor equipment/material jams with tongs or pliers.
  • Complete paperwork as required.
  • Keep work area clean.
  • Perform other job-related duties as required or assigned by management.
